About LipSyncX Alternatives
LipSyncX is an AI-powered lip sync video generator that falls into the content creation and video production category, specifically designed to transform scripts, audio clips, photos, and existing video sources into natural-looking talking head videos. It is built for creators, marketers, educators, and developers who need long-form video support, multilingual workflows, and scalable automated production. While LipSyncX offers a pay-as-you-go model at a competitive rate, users often start looking for alternatives when their needs shift—perhaps they require a different pricing structure for high-volume output, need specific platform integrations that LipSyncX does not support, or want features like more advanced avatar customization, offline editing capabilities, or a free tier to test the waters before committing. Others might simply be exploring the market to compare ease of use or find a tool that better fits their team’s existing software stack. When choosing an alternative to LipSyncX, it is important to focus on the core factors that align with your specific workflow. Look for a solution that supports your preferred input methods—whether that is script-to-video, audio-to-video, or photo animation—and check if the output quality matches the natural lip-sync realism you need. Consider the pricing model carefully: some tools charge per second like LipSyncX, while others offer monthly subscriptions or volume discounts. Also evaluate the platform’s language support, especially if you work with multilingual content, and verify whether it provides a REST API for automation if you are a developer or part of a large marketing team. Finally, review the maximum video length allowed, as some tools cap short-form clips, whereas LipSyncX is designed for long-form content, making this a critical differentiator.

Is LipSyncX free?
No, LipSyncX is not free. It operates on a pay-as-you-go pricing model at $0.05 per second of generated video. This means you only pay for the content you create, which can be cost-effective for both small projects and large-scale production. There is no mention of a free tier or trial in the provided information, so users should plan to purchase credits or fund an account to get started.
